
在Excel文档中将网址转化成二维码的方法主要包括:使用在线二维码生成器、利用Excel内置功能、使用VBA代码。本文将详细介绍这三种方法,并提供详细的操作步骤和注意事项。
一、使用在线二维码生成器
在线二维码生成器是最简单快捷的方法之一,只需将网址输入生成器并生成二维码图片,然后将图片插入到Excel文档中即可。以下是具体步骤:
- 选择在线二维码生成器:有很多在线二维码生成器可供选择,如二维码生成器(QR Code Generator)、QRCode Monkey等。
- 输入网址:在生成器的输入框中输入你想要转换成二维码的网址。
- 生成二维码:点击生成按钮,生成对应的网址二维码。
- 下载二维码图片:将生成的二维码图片下载到本地计算机。
- 插入Excel文档:打开Excel文档,选择需要插入二维码的位置,点击“插入”选项卡,选择“图片”,然后找到并插入下载的二维码图片。
二、利用Excel内置功能
Excel本身并没有直接生成二维码的功能,但可以通过一些插件或第三方工具来实现。以下是利用Excel插件生成二维码的方法:
- 安装Excel插件:有一些插件可以帮助在Excel中生成二维码,如【QR4Office】。在Excel中,点击“插入”选项卡,选择“获取外接程序”,然后搜索并安装相关插件。
- 生成二维码:安装插件后,在Excel文档中选择需要生成二维码的网址单元格,然后使用插件的功能生成二维码。
- 调整二维码大小和位置:生成二维码后,可能需要调整其大小和位置以适应表格布局。
三、使用VBA代码
如果需要批量生成二维码或进行自动化操作,可以使用VBA代码来实现。以下是具体步骤:
- 打开VBA编辑器:在Excel中按【Alt】+【F11】打开VBA编辑器。
- 插入模块:在VBA编辑器中,选择“插入”→“模块”,插入一个新模块。
- 编写代码:在模块中输入以下代码:
Sub GenerateQRCode()
Dim URL As String
Dim QRCodeURL As String
Dim i As Integer
Dim LastRow As Long
' 获取最后一行
LastRow = Cells(Rows.Count, 1).End(xlUp).Row
For i = 1 To LastRow
' 从第一列获取网址
URL = Cells(i, 1).Value
' 生成二维码的API URL
QRCodeURL = "https://chart.googleapis.com/chart?chs=150x150&cht=qr&chl=" & URL
' 将二维码插入到第二列
With ActiveSheet.Pictures.Insert(QRCodeURL)
.Left = Cells(i, 2).Left
.Top = Cells(i, 2).Top
.Width = Cells(i, 2).Width
.Height = Cells(i, 2).Height
End With
Next i
End Sub
- 运行代码:关闭VBA编辑器,返回Excel,按【Alt】+【F8】打开宏对话框,选择刚才创建的宏(GenerateQRCode),点击“运行”。
四、注意事项和技巧
- 二维码的清晰度:生成二维码时,确保其尺寸足够大,以保证扫描时的清晰度和准确性。
- 二维码的存储位置:如果在Excel中插入大量二维码图片,可能会导致文件变大,影响Excel的性能。
- 批量处理:使用VBA代码可以批量生成二维码,提高效率,但需要注意代码的正确性和执行效率。
- 数据安全:如果二维码包含敏感信息,注意数据的安全性,避免未经授权的访问和使用。
五、总结
在Excel文档中将网址转化成二维码有多种方法,包括使用在线生成器、Excel插件和VBA代码。在线生成器简单快捷,适合少量网址的转换;Excel插件功能丰富,适合经常需要生成二维码的用户;VBA代码则适合批量处理,提高工作效率。根据具体需求选择合适的方法,可以大大提升工作效率和数据处理能力。
通过以上方法,可以轻松实现Excel文档中网址向二维码的转换,使数据展示更加直观和便捷。同时,掌握这些技巧和方法,也能在日常工作中更好地处理和管理数据,提高工作效率。
相关问答FAQs:
1. 如何将Excel文档中的网址转化为二维码?
您可以使用在线或离线的二维码生成器,将Excel文档中的网址转化为二维码。这些生成器通常允许您粘贴或导入Excel中的网址,然后生成相应的二维码图像。
2. 有哪些在线二维码生成器可以将Excel文档中的网址转化为二维码?
有许多在线工具可以帮助您将Excel文档中的网址转化为二维码。一些受欢迎的选择包括QR Code Generator、ZXing QR Code Generator和QR Stuff等。您只需访问这些网站,将Excel文档中的网址粘贴到相应的输入框中,然后点击生成二维码即可。
3. 能否在Excel中直接生成二维码而无需使用在线工具?
是的,您可以使用Excel的宏或插件来直接生成二维码,而无需使用在线工具。有一些宏和插件可以帮助您在Excel中创建二维码,您只需按照它们的说明安装和使用即可。这种方法可以更加方便,尤其是当您需要频繁生成二维码时。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4691972